Dr. Victor Spoormaker is a Research Professor and Group Leader at the Max Planck Institute of Psychiatry's Department of Genes and Environment, where he directs the Psychophysiology Lab. He is affiliated with the Scientific-Therapeutic Outpatient Clinic and has previously conducted research in the Netherlands and England.
His research focuses on translational psychiatry, integrating clinical psychology and neuroscience through physiological biomarkers. Key interests include:
- Affective processes and emotion-related biomarkers
- Sleep disorders, particularly nightmares and PTSD
- Neuroimaging (fMRI) and psychophysiological measurements
- Wearable technology for at-home monitoring
Recent publications (2014–2025) emphasize neuroimaging of fear conditioning, multi-omics in depression, sleep therapeutics, and nightmare etiology. Trends show a strong focus on large-scale clinical neuroscience and biomarker validation.
Dr. Spoormaker leads projects using the institute's MRI, VR lab, and wearables to advance objective diagnostics in psychiatry.
